Synopsis
August 1914. While the German army is gaining ground in the North of France, four boys aged 10 to 15, LUcien, LUcas, LUigi and LUdwig are left behind during the evacuation of their orphanage. Without the protection of Abbé Turpin and the schoolteacher Leutellier, the Lulus are now stranded on their own behind the enemy front line. Soon joined by LUce, a pretty young girl separated from her parents, they decide to reach the neutral country of Switzerland by all means possible... they embark on an adventure for which nothing and no one has prepared them!
Community Reviews
Audience reactions to 'La guerre des Lulus' are generally positive, highlighting its emotional depth and historical setting that captivates both children and adults. Viewers praised the film for its engaging storytelling and strong performances, particularly noting its ability to evoke a range of emotions from laughter to tears. The realistic settings and the portrayal of the orphans' adventures during WWI were frequently commended. However, some found the plot somewhat predictable and the pacing uneven at times.
